Transaction 68fc168c19f86973ad8f00e24e3560fb1818f24fcd0732d5e4a057d6fa7b90f3
1 Input
1 Output
-
68fc168c19f86973ad8f00e24e3560fb1818f24fcd0732d5e4a057d6fa7b90f3:0
- value
- 3561643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b13b11b7127596b7d814f27e69f4944a491ec25c OP_EQUAL
- address
- 3Hr8HhRGS1crR8GDM3bx3TPeEAWWLtDV59